Hai teman-teman...di sini saya ingin berbagi tugas
dengan kalian...hahaha...santai udah ada jawabannya kok...hihihi...
Hari ini adalah hari kedua saya belajar mengenai
Pengetahuan Teknologi Sistem Cerdas.
Pada hari kedua belajar , saya mendapatkan 2 tugas :
1. Konsep Teknologi Sistem Cerdas :
a. Expert System
b. Decision Support System
2. Contoh Sistem Cerdas !
Baiklah disini saya akan langsung menjawab tugas No. 1
===================================================
KONSEP TEKNOLOGI SISTEM CERDAS
...........................................................
Di dalam perspektif ilmu pengetahuan dan teknologi, sistem cerdas merupakan bagian
...........................................................
Di dalam perspektif ilmu pengetahuan dan teknologi, sistem cerdas merupakan bagian
dari bidang inteligensia semu (Artificial
Intelligence/AI).
a.EXPERT SYSTEM
_Istilah expert system berasal dari knowledge-based expert system (sistem cerdas berbasis pengetahuan) , dimana suatu sistem yang menggunakan pengetahuan manusia (human knowledge) yang dimasukkan ke dalam komputer untuk memecahkan masalah yang umumnya memerlukan keahlian seorang pakar/expert. Atau dapat juga dikatakan, sebuah program komputer yang menggunakan pengetahuan dan teknik inferensi (pengambilan kesimpulan) untuk memecahkan persoalan seperti yang dilakukan oleh seorang pakar.
Berbeda dengan program komputer biasa , sistem cerdas dapat digunakan untuk memecahkan masalah yang tidak terstruktur dan dimana tidak ada suatu prosedur tertentu untuk memecahkan masalah tersebut. Sedangkan definisi pengetahuan (knowledge) menurut Webster's New World Dictionary of the American Language: persepsi tentang sesuatu yang jelas dan tentu, semua yang telah dirasakan dan diterima oleh otak , serta merupakan informasi terorganisasi yang dapat diterapkan untuk penyelesaian masalah.
Penggunaan Knowledge-based expert system (sistem pakar berbasis pengetahuan) ini tidak menjamin solusi yang lebih akurat , tetapi paling tidak mampu menghasilkan keputusan-keputusan yang didasari informasi relatif lebih banyak/terstruktur. Sesuai dengan namanya , suatu "Sistem Pakar" akan sangat tergantung pada pengetahuan (knowledge) yang didapat dari pakar yang menyumbangkan keahlian dan pengalamannya.
a.EXPERT SYSTEM
_Istilah expert system berasal dari knowledge-based expert system (sistem cerdas berbasis pengetahuan) , dimana suatu sistem yang menggunakan pengetahuan manusia (human knowledge) yang dimasukkan ke dalam komputer untuk memecahkan masalah yang umumnya memerlukan keahlian seorang pakar/expert. Atau dapat juga dikatakan, sebuah program komputer yang menggunakan pengetahuan dan teknik inferensi (pengambilan kesimpulan) untuk memecahkan persoalan seperti yang dilakukan oleh seorang pakar.
Berbeda dengan program komputer biasa , sistem cerdas dapat digunakan untuk memecahkan masalah yang tidak terstruktur dan dimana tidak ada suatu prosedur tertentu untuk memecahkan masalah tersebut. Sedangkan definisi pengetahuan (knowledge) menurut Webster's New World Dictionary of the American Language: persepsi tentang sesuatu yang jelas dan tentu, semua yang telah dirasakan dan diterima oleh otak , serta merupakan informasi terorganisasi yang dapat diterapkan untuk penyelesaian masalah.
Penggunaan Knowledge-based expert system (sistem pakar berbasis pengetahuan) ini tidak menjamin solusi yang lebih akurat , tetapi paling tidak mampu menghasilkan keputusan-keputusan yang didasari informasi relatif lebih banyak/terstruktur. Sesuai dengan namanya , suatu "Sistem Pakar" akan sangat tergantung pada pengetahuan (knowledge) yang didapat dari pakar yang menyumbangkan keahlian dan pengalamannya.
Biasanya
suatu "sistem cerdas" dapat dibagi menjadi beberapa bagian:
(1).
Basis pengetahuan (knowledge-base)
_berisi pengetahuan yang spesifik mengenai domain tertentu yang mana basis pengetahuan ini dapat diperbaharui sesuai dengan tingkat kemampuan seorang expert terhadap pemecahan suatu masalah.
_berisi pengetahuan yang spesifik mengenai domain tertentu yang mana basis pengetahuan ini dapat diperbaharui sesuai dengan tingkat kemampuan seorang expert terhadap pemecahan suatu masalah.
(2). Mesin inferensi (Inference Engine)
_suatu program yang bertugas mengolah data masukan sesuai pengetahuan dalam basis pengetahuan , menurut kaidah-kaidah tertentu.
_suatu program yang bertugas mengolah data masukan sesuai pengetahuan dalam basis pengetahuan , menurut kaidah-kaidah tertentu.
( 3).
Bagian kendali/user interface
_bagian yang berkomunikasi langsung dengan pengguna (user) sistem. Ada 2 (dua) macam mesin inferensi , yaitu yang bersifat pasti (deterministik) dan kemungkinan (propabilistik)
_bagian yang berkomunikasi langsung dengan pengguna (user) sistem. Ada 2 (dua) macam mesin inferensi , yaitu yang bersifat pasti (deterministik) dan kemungkinan (propabilistik)
b.Decision Support System
_Sistem Pendukung Keputusan (Inggris: Decision Support Systems disingkat DSS) adalah bagian dari sistem informasi berbasis komputer (termasuk sistem berbasis pengetahuan/manajemen pengetahuan) yang dipakai untuk mendukung pengambilan keputusan dalam suatu organisasi atau perusahaan. Dapat juga dikatakan sebagai sistem komputer yang mengolah data menjadi informasi untuk mengambil keputusan dari masalah semi-terstruktur yang spesifik. Sistem Pendukung Keputusan mulai dikembangkan pada tahun 1970. DSS dengan didukung oleh sebuah sistem informasi berbasis komputer dapat membantu seseorang dalam meningkatkan kinerjanya dalam pengambilan keputusan. Seorang manajer/pimpinan di suatu perusahaan/organisasi dapat memecahkan masalah semi struktur, di mana manajer dan komputer harus bekerja sama sebagai tim pemecah masalah dalam memecahkan masalah yang berada di area semi struktur. DSS mendayagunakan resources individu-individu secara intelek dengan kemampuan komputer untuk meningkatkan kualitas keputusan.
_Sistem Pendukung Keputusan (Inggris: Decision Support Systems disingkat DSS) adalah bagian dari sistem informasi berbasis komputer (termasuk sistem berbasis pengetahuan/manajemen pengetahuan) yang dipakai untuk mendukung pengambilan keputusan dalam suatu organisasi atau perusahaan. Dapat juga dikatakan sebagai sistem komputer yang mengolah data menjadi informasi untuk mengambil keputusan dari masalah semi-terstruktur yang spesifik. Sistem Pendukung Keputusan mulai dikembangkan pada tahun 1970. DSS dengan didukung oleh sebuah sistem informasi berbasis komputer dapat membantu seseorang dalam meningkatkan kinerjanya dalam pengambilan keputusan. Seorang manajer/pimpinan di suatu perusahaan/organisasi dapat memecahkan masalah semi struktur, di mana manajer dan komputer harus bekerja sama sebagai tim pemecah masalah dalam memecahkan masalah yang berada di area semi struktur. DSS mendayagunakan resources individu-individu secara intelek dengan kemampuan komputer untuk meningkatkan kualitas keputusan.
http://staff.uny.ac.id/sites/default/files/penelitian/Saliman,%20Drs.%20M.Pd./Mengenal%20DSS.pdf
==============================================================
Setelah menjawab tugas No. 1 , saya akan menjawab
tugas No.2
Untuk
menjawab tugas no 2 , saya akan mengambil contoh sistem cerdas yaitu “SISTEM
CERDAS DIAGNOSA PENYAKIT AYAM” dari eprints.dinus.ac.id/15233/1/jurnal_15222.pdf.
Sistem
cerdas ini dibuat dalam bentuk suatu aplikasi.Aplikasi ini digunakan sebagai tambahan
informasi bagi penyuluh peternakan , karena ayam merupakan jenis unggas yang
paling diminati untuk diternakkan, karena selain perawatannya mudah , menjadi kebutuhan
masyarakat modern dan menjadi sumber ekonomi yang menjanjikan.Sehingga
perawatan dan pemeliharaan yang intensif pada ayam akan menghasilkan keuntungan
yang berlipat. Penggunaan sistem cerdas dengan metode forward chaining ini diterapkan
menggunakan aplikasi web , sebab dengan menggunakan aplikasi web, user dapat
dengan mudah dan cepat mengakses sistem.
Ada beberapa manfaat yang akan kita dapatkan pada
saat kita menggunakan aplikasi “Sistem Cerdas Diagnosa Penyakit Ayam” :
1. Mengenalkan sistem cerdas
kepada masyarakat , dalam hal ini para “Peternak Ayam”.
2. Memberikan kemudahan
kepada para peternak ayam untuk mengetahui gejala penyakit atau penyakit yang
diderita unggasnya.
3. Membantu dokter hewan
mengambil keputusan dalam mengidentifikasi penyakit ayam.
4. Hasil penelitian dapat
digunakan sebagai bahan acuan bagi para peneliti berikutnya yang akan membahas
mengenai masalah sistem cerdas.
Nah
sekarang mari kita langsung membahas aplikasinya.
1. Halaman Utama User
_Halaman
ini akan terlihat ketika user pertama kali membuka aplikasinya.Disini juga ada beberapa
menu utama seperti Home , Konsultasi, dan Administrator untuk login ke halaman
administrator.
2. Menu Home
_Di
menu ini terdapat penjelasan mengenai hal-hal yang berkaitan dengan “Ayam”.
_Di
menu ini terdapat form yang harus diisi oleh user sebelum menjawab pertanyaan
yang akan diajukan pada halaman berikutnya.
Setelah
user mengisi form tersebut , maka dihalaman berikutnya , user akan disajikan berbagai pertanyaan mengenai
gejala yang terjadi dalam masalah penyakit ayam sehingga hasil akhirnya dapat
diketahui masalah apa yang terjadi.
4. Menu Administrator
_Di
menu ini terdapat Form Login Admin yang digunakan oleh admin dalam memasukkan ,
mengubah , ataupun menghapus data sistem pakar tersebut.
Oh
iya kawan , ada beberapa hal yang perlu kalian tahu lagi nih mengenai aplikasi
ini :
1. Sistem aplikasi sistem
cerdas ini telah dilakukan pengujian untuk mendiagnosa penyakit ayam, dan
diharapkan mampu untuk diaplikasikan dalam dunia nyata.
2. Sistem ini dirancang
dengan menggunakan kaidah produksi yang yang diharapkan bisa mengukur tingkat
kepercayaan user terhadap sistem dan hal ini merupakan syarat yang seharusnya
ada dalam sebuah aplikasi sistem cerdas.
3. Aplikasi ini dibangun
menggunakan PHP dan MySQL dan aplikasi ini bersifat Multi User sehingga mampu
digunakan oleh banyak pengguna secara intranet maupun internet.
4. Aplikasi Sistem cerdas
ini telah dilengkapi dengan fasilitas update data bagi Pakar sehingga bisa di
update datanya sesuai dengan keperluan.
Aplikasi ini juga masih memiliki kekurangan kawan :
1. Pada aplikasi ini
digunakan kriteria yang hanya berupa gejala fisik dari ayam, pengembangan lebih
lanjut sebaiknya menggunakan kriteria lainnya seperti hasil pemeriksaan
laboratorium sehingga hasil diagnosa menjadi lebih tepat dan akurat.
2. Pengembangan program dan
analisis data agar dapat lebih diperluas cakupannya sesuai dengan kebutuhan
program.
3. Dalam memelihara
keakuratan data pada aplikasi ini maka perlu dilakukan proses update basis
pengetahuan secara berkala.
4. Sistem yang dibangun ini
masih memiliki banyak kekurangan, baik dari segi fungsionalitas maupun data
yang dimiliki. Oleh karena itu, sangat dibutuhkan berbagai pengembangan lebih
lanjut agar dapat memberikan lebih banyak lagi manfaat bagi masyarakat luas.
======================================================
======================================================
Baiklah teman...
Sampai
disini dulu ya untuk berbagi tugas kali ini...
Semoga bermanfaat bagi kita
semua...
Tidak ada komentar:
Posting Komentar